DBX Films is a video production company based in Dubai, Abu Dhabi and the UAE. We produce high-quality videos for brands, businesses and organizations across a range of industries. Our team of talented filmmakers has a passion for telling stories that capture the essence of our client’s brands and businesses, and we use the latest technology and equipment to bring these stories to life.